Which of the following is the most suitable temperature and pressure conditions for production of methanol by catalytic hydrogenation? Correct Answer 600K, 300atm

Methanol is produced by catalytic hydrogenation of carbon monoxide at high pressure (200-300atm) and high temperature (573-673K) in the presence of ZnO-Cr2O3 catalyst.
